中文摘要: |
本文介绍了基于3DGIS和VR仿真技术构建的三维航标助航系统的方法。该系统实现了基本航标及船舶的定位、查询、增删,给航标增加航距灯罩,增加动态布设航标功能,突显航标的作用。在美观性方面,重点通过加强场景模拟过程中地形和地物细节的渲染,应用Vega Prime 2.1中更新后的天空和海洋模块表现环境效果,采用改进后的粒子系统和L系统,利用OSG图形包进行天气模拟,改进Vega Prime中的天气模拟效果。本文作为优化三维航标助航系统模拟方法的一次探索,为日后系统的深入研究及应用推广打下基础。

外文摘要: |
This paper introduces a simulation method based on 3DGIS and VR technology to realize aids to navigation. The system achieves positioning, inquiring, adding and deleting navigation mark and ship. To highlight the role of navigation, in the system visual distance of beacon light can be shown and dynamic layout of navigation becomes feasible. In terms of system appearance, the process of rendering details for terrain and other features is strengthened. At the same time, simulate environment by sky and ocean module updated in Vega Prime 2.1, and optimize particle system and L-System to improve weather effect made by OSG graphics package instead of VP. As an exploration of optimizing simulation method in aids to navigation system, this study lays foundation of future in-depth study and promotion in the field of navigation.
